Zrobi?em sobie skrypt dzi?ki kt?remu po wej?ciu do markera otwieraj? si? automatycznie drzwi. Czy da si? do takiego skryptu dorobi? ?eby drzwi mog?a otworzy? tylko konkretna posta??
Witam, ostatnio us?ysza?em ?e jest mo?liwo?? aby tekstury obiektu podmienia?y si? tylko na jaki? jeden dimension lub interior. Przeszukiwa?em wiele for i jednak tego nie znalaz?em. Wie kto? mo?e jak to zrobi??
Oczywi?cie jak napisa? skrypt na podmienianie tekstur wiem ale nie wiem jak tylko pod dany dimension lub interior.
Witam. Mam taki problem, ot?? przerabia?em m?j stary system respektu na system g?odu i natrafi?em na problem. Gdy odpal? skrypt to jest dobrze bo usuwa 1 punkt w minut?, ale drugi raz ju? nie usunie. po 100 ustawia na 99 i dalej ju? si? nie ruszy. Wiecie o co chodzi? Przecie? setTimer jest ustawiony na niesko?czono?? razy
local player = getLocalPlayer ()
local data = getElementData(player, "Respekt") or 100
function resp_minuta ()
setElementData (player, "Respekt", data - 1)
end
setTimer (resp_minuta, 60*1000, 0)
function sprawdz_poziom_glodu ()
glod = getElementData (player, "Respekt")
if glod == 0 then
killPlayer (player)
outputChatBox ("* Umar?e? z g?odu! Trzeba by?o co? zje??!", 255, 0, 0)
elseif glod == 10 then
outputChatBox ("Powoli robisz si? g?odny. Znajd? co? do jedzenia!")
end
end
setTimer (sprawdz_poziom_glodu, 60*1000, 0)[/lua]
Witajcie! Czy jest jaka? funkcja w Lua w kt?rej po kt?rej b?d? m?g? tylko raz pos?u?y? si? dan? komend?, oraz z informacj? na chacie ?e ju? raz u?y?em tej komendy?
Witam, chcia?bym si? spyta? jak doda?, aby chat by? tylko dla kogo? kto jest w ACL
"Premium" ? Chodzi mi o globala..
Skrypt By [color=orange][b]DaxRel69[/b][/color]
Kod:
[lua]
function RGBToHex(red, green, blue, alpha)
if((red < 0 or red > 255 or green < 0 or green > 255 or blue < 0 or blue > 255) or (alpha and (alpha < 0 or alpha > 255))) then
return nil
end
if(alpha) then
return string.format("#%.2X%.2X%.2X%.2X", red,green,blue,alpha)
else
return string.format("#%.2X%.2X%.2X", red,green,blue)
end
end
function onChat(message,messagetype)
if isGuestAccount(getPlayerAccount(source)) then
outputChatBox("Najpierw wejd? do gry.", source, 255, 000, 000)
return end
if messagetype == 0 then
cancelEvent()
local x, y, z = getElementPosition(source)
local chatCol = createColSphere(x,y,z,20)
local chatRadius = getElementsWithinColShape(chatCol)
local r, g, b = getPlayerNametagColor(source)
for key, value in ipairs(chatRadius) do
outputChatBox(getPlayerName(source).."#FFFFFF: "..message,value,r,g,b,true)
end
outputServerLog("LOCAL "..getPlayerName(source)..": "..message)
-- if not isPedInVehicle(source) then
--local talktime = string.len(message)*200
Komendy tylko dla Adma mam za sob? powiedzmy, teraz chcialbym by dany zas?b dzia?a? tylko dla mnie <Admina>
Mozna wgl tak zrobic ?
W przyblizeniu: Mam handling editor, chce by dost?p do niego mial tylko Admin czyli ja.
[ Dodano: 2015-07-15, 00:26 ]
Znalaz?em to, nie wiem czy mi pomo?e
Witam mam np skrypt na antybicie czyli ze sie nie da bi? nikogo ani strzela? i bym chcial zeby np tylko grupa acl Admin mog?a strzelac tylko z broni np id 24 a jak we?mie inn? to poprostu nie mo?e tak samo bi? nie mo?e.
I jak zawsze za pomoc
Mam taki kod, og??em dzia?a? ale chcia?em dorobi? by nie mo?na by?o pokaza? dowodu go?ciowi kt?ry jest o 5000m od ciebie wi?c pos?u?y?em si? mym czatem regionowym i p?tl?, nie mam poj?cia czemu nie dzia?a, og??em nie wywala ?adnego db.
Mo?e inaczej to zrobi?, jakie? propozycje?
[lua] local acc = getPlayerAccount(thePlayer)
local czymasz = getAccountData(acc, "dowod")
if komu then
if (czymasz==1) then
local komutype = getPlayerFromName(komu)
if komutype then
local posX, posY, posZ = getElementPosition( thePlayer )
local chatSphere = createColSphere( posX, posY, posZ, 8 )
local nearbyPlayers = getElementsWithinColShape( chatSphere, "player" )
destroyElement( chatSphere )
for k,v in ipairs ( getElementsByType ( "nearbyPlayers" )) do
if (v==komutype) then
local prawojazdy = getAccountData(acc,"prawojazdy")
local licencjap = getAccountData(acc, "licencjapilota")
local pozwolenie = getAccountData(acc, "weaponlic")
local name = getPlayerName(thePlayer)
local level = getAccountData(acc,"level")
if (prawojazdy==1) then
praweczko = "Tak"
else
praweczko = "Nie"
end
if (licencjap==1) then
lickapilka = "Tak"
else
lickapilka = "Nie"
end
Witam,
mam pytanie czy jest mo?liwo?? ?e po wci?ni?ciu buttona, tylko nam podmieni np. pojazd 415 na dan? podmiank??
Prosz? o odpowied? ewentualnie kod
Nie dziala timer dla zmniejszania glodu dla gracza powyzej id 0, tylko dla id 0 dziala. Czytalem mnostwo tematow, ale zaden mi nie pomogl, dlatego pisze tutaj.
Posiadam timer w "OnGameModeInit":
Oraz funkcje:
Po zmianie timera na:
Wyrzuca blad ze nie ma zdefinowanego playerid. Wrzucilem timer do "OnPlayerConnect". Ju? nie wyrzuca warningow przy konwertowaniu, lecz nadal nie zabiera zarcia, tylko dla id 0. Macie pomysl jak to naprawic ?
Witam chcia?bym aby marker dzia?a? tylko dla odpowiedniego teamu , ?eby by? ale po wej?ciu gracze z nie odpowiednim teamem wyskakiwa?a wiadomo??.Za pomoc piwko
Witajcie! Napisa?em skrypcik, na wezwania... Lecz nie wiem jak odwo?a? si? ?eby pokazywa?o tylko w frakcji kt?r? wezwali?my wezwanie, a nie wszystkim graczom. Oto potrzebne linijki:
Witam, posiadam problem z serwerem, mianowicie na serwerze mo?e przebywa? tylko jedna osoba.
Ka?dej kolejnej kt?ra wejdzie nie wy?wietla si? okno logowania i nie ma ?adnych funkcji gamemoda, dodatkowo po wej?ciu na serwer tej "drugiej" osoby w logach zostaj? b??dy.
[code][16:40:06] [join] John_Smith has joined the server (1:89.72.25.147)
[16:40:06] [debug] Run time error 4: "Array index out of bounds"
[16:40:06] [debug] Accessing element at index 1 past array upper bound 0
[16:40:06] [debug] AMX backtrace:
[16:40:06] [debug] #0 0000f144 in public SSCANF_OnPlayerConnect (0x00000001) from rp.amx
[16:40:06] [debug] #1 native CallLocalFunction () [080dbf60] from samp03svr
[16:40:06] [debug] #2 00000600 in public OnPlayerConnect (0x00000001) from rp.amx
[16:40:06] [debug] Run time error 4: "Array index out of bounds"
[16:40:06] [debug] Accessing element at index 1 past array upper bound 0
[16:40:06] [debug] AMX backtrace:
[16:40:06] [debug] #0 0002cf5c in public OnPlayerRequestClass (0x00000001, 0x00000000) from rp.amx
[16:40:11] [debug] Run time error 4: "Array index out of bounds"
[16:40:11] [debug] Accessing element at index 1 past array upper bound 0
[16:40:11] [debug] AMX backtrace:
[16:40:11] [debug] #0 0002cf5c in public OnPlayerRequestClass (0x00000001, 0x00000000) from rp.amx
[16:40:11] [debug] Run time error 4: "Array index out of bounds"
[16:40:11] [debug] Accessing element at index 1 past array u...
Witam, zrobi?em sobie gui, okej, nast?pnie triggerClientEvent("onGui", source)
ale te gui wy?wietla si? ka?demu jak ja wejd? w marker, wie kto? jak? funkcj? zastosowa? aby wy?wietla?o si? gui dla jednego gracza po stronie clienta?
Chodzi mi tutaj o system prywatnych pojazd?w. Ot?? kiedy wsi?d? do nie swojego auta pojawia mi si? komunikat ?e pojazd nale?y do i nie mo?esz go prowadzi? i powinno wyrzuci? nas z auta jednak tak si? nie dzieje mo?emy dalej nim sie porusza?. Wie kto? gdzie lezy b??d? Bo ja ju? nie mam pomys?u
Witam. czy kto? z was m?g? by mi pom?c zrobi? komend?.
Komenda ma polega? na: gdy policjant wpisze t? komend? to policjantowi na mini mapie pojawia si? jaka? ikona przesuwaj?ca si? razem z pozycj? gracza podanego w komendzie(id gracza) .
Witam jak zrobi? aby dana komenda dzia?a tylko w wyznaczonym pickupie a gdy gracz
jest poza pickupem i wpisze komend? to wyskoczy napis Musisz by? w pikcupie!
Mam pytanie bo mam w gm tak, ?e ?eby u?y? opcji VIP'a musz? by? na skinie, a ja chce tak ?eby np. jestem na skinie Pomocy Drogowej,Kierowcy itd. to ?eby VIP'a mo?na by?o u?ywa? nie tylko na skinie. Je?li chcecie wycinek kodu piszcie kt?r? cz??? kodu
witam,
mam problem w moim Gmie robilem komendy i system uzywajac playerid.
ale teraz wszystko tylko dziala an id 0 !
nawet textdrawy !
tu macie przyklad komendy !
id 0 normalnie dziala ale inne id np. 1 itp nie dziala !
za pomoc piwko + Respekt
Mia? by? do tego by tylko osoby z rang? mog?y u?ywa? pojazd?w o id 525 jak si? jednak okaza?o osoba bez rangi te? mo?e do niego wej??.Co jest ?le ?Za pomoc piwko.
Ten Timer jest tworzony gdy gracz wejdzie do pojazdy a zabijany gdy wyjdzie. I z tym jest problem ?e ten timer tworzy si? tylko wtedy gdy gracz o ID 0 wejdzie do pojazdu a jak wyjdzie to zabijany jest. I moje pytanie dlaczego mo?e go nie tworzy? dla reszty graczy ?
Witam , co mam zrobi? by dodany mod by? dost?pny tylko dla admina ?
Mianowicie chc? by pod klawiszem np F10 pojawia?o si? okno teleport?w . Skrypt ju? mam , ale chce by tylko admin m?g? z niego korzysta? .
Pozdrawiam , z g?ry dzi?kuj? za pomoc.
Mam problemik, poniewa? mam mapk? truck z systemem score ale niestety score dodaje sie tylko dla gracza o ID 0. Jak zrobic aby kazdy gracz dostawal score ?
zainstalowa?em dzi? na VPS serwer 0.3e , chcia?em postawi? na nim map? - do tego czasu by?o wszystko ok , z tym ze robi?em to u kolegi na kompie , poszed?em do sb , wkleilem IP serwa do swojego SAMP'a i ?
HostName: (Retrieving info...) IP SERWA ( NIE CHCE REKLAMOWA? )
Address: IP SERWA ( NIE CHCE REKLAMOWA? )
Players: 0 / 0
Ping: 9999
Mode:
Map:
dodam ?e pisa?em do kumpli - im r?wnie? wszystko cyka jak nale?y . nwm o co chodzi ...
Witam. Chcia?bym uzyska? taki efekt, jak na tym filmiku od 18 sekundy.
Chodzi o obiekt ?wiec?cych kierunkowskaz?w.
Znalaz?em podobne ID obiektu, ale one ?wiec? wy??cznie w godzinach 20-6. Jak wi?c zrobi? by ?wieci?y ca?y czas?[/code]